Closing Grain and Livestock Futures: March 25, 2026

May corn $4.67 and 1/4, up 4 and 3/4 centsMay soybeans $11.71 and 3/4, up 16 and 3/4 centsMay soybean meal $319.80, down $2.60May soybean oil 67.10, up 137 pointsMay Chicago wheat $5.97 and 3/4, up 7 and 3/4 centsApr. live cattle $234.42, down 95 centsApr. feeder cattle $353.35, down $1.10Apr. lean hogs $90.90, down […]
